# Partner SFTP drop — Brindlemoor feeds
#
# New to the team? This module polls the Brindlemoor partner drop for
# nightly inventory files, validates checksums, and moves them into the
# ingest queue. Files can arrive late or in bursts, so polling cadence
# and retry limits matter more than you'd think. Don't change these
# without looping in the ingest on-call. The constants governing the
# poller are defined just below.

limits module of kawef-hawef:
TIERS = {
    "belax": 967,
    "gorvan": 210,
    "ulair": 473,
}

**Q: Why does Pixelvane's thumbnail cache keep eating memory?**

Short version: the image cache in Pixelvane 3.2 never evicts entries when the gallery view closes, so long sessions balloon past 2 GB. Telling users to restart works, but the real fix lands in 3.3. If a customer's vault locks up during the crash, you can restore it with the standard phrase below.

strongbox words: oliath-framir

☐ Query Planner Regression (Dovetail DB v9.2): Confirm that slow-query alerts tied to the planner regression have been triaged, that affected customers received the mitigation notice, and that the hotfix flag `planner_legacy_mode` is enabled on impacted clusters. Support should log any new reports against the open incident rather than filing fresh tickets. Verify weekly until the permanent fix ships in v9.3. Escalations route to the owner named below.

account owner for bawip-tahag: Raleth Quenok